More on Ephraim ben Shemarya
Ephraim ben Shemarya was head of the Jerusalem congregation at Fustāt during the years 1000—c. 1055 and was among the leading persons of Fustāt during this period. Several studies on Ephraim ben Shemarya have already been published and a monograph discussing his personality and deeds is now in press...
